Как поставить модуль в формулу Excel: полное руководство

Работа с числовыми данными в электронных таблицах часто требует оперирования только положительными значениями, игнорируя их знак. В математике это понятие называется модулем числа, и в среде Microsoft Excel для его вычисления существует специальный инструментарий. Пользователи, сталкивающиеся с необходимостью игнорировать отрицательные знаки при расчетах, должны освоить функцию ABS, которая является стандартом для таких операций. Без понимания этого механизма построение корректных финансовых отчетов или статистических выборок становится невозможным.

В отличие от обычных арифметических операторов, модуль требует применения встроенной математической функции. Просто изменить знак вручную в больших массивах данных не получится, поэтому автоматизация процесса через формулы становится обязательной. В этой статье мы детально разберем синтаксис, практическое применение и скрытые возможности работы с абсолютными значениями. Вы научитесь не только ставить модуль, но и интегрировать его в сложные логические цепочки.

Понятие модуля и его роль в вычислениях

Модуль числа в математике — это расстояние от начала координат до точки, изображающей это число на числовой прямой. Это означает, что модуль всегда неотрицателен: значение числа -5 и 5 по модулю будет одинаковым и равным 5. В Excel эта концепция реализована через функцию ABS (от английского Absolute), которая возвращает модуль числа. Использование этой операции критически важно, когда знак числа не имеет значения для конечного результата, например, при расчете суммарной площади или объема.

Часто новички пытаются просто убрать минус визуально, меняя формат ячеек, но это не меняет underlying value (внутреннее значение) для формул. Для корректных вычислений необходимо именно преобразовать данные. Если вы работаете с финансовыми потерями и прибылью, где нужно оценить общий оборот средств без учета направления транзакции, применение модуля становится базовой необходимостью. Игнорирование знака позволяет сосредоточиться на масштабе явления.

Рассмотрим пример, где важно понимать разницу между обычным числом и его абсолютным значением. Представьте, что вы анализируете температурные отклонения от нормы: -3 градуса и +3 градуса. Для статистики амплитуды колебаний важно, что отклонение составило 3 единицы в обоих случаях. Функция ABS позволяет унифицировать эти данные, превращая их в положительные величины для дальнейшего суммирования или усреднения.

Синтаксис и базовое использование функции ABS

Чтобы поставить модуль в формулу, необходимо использовать стандартный синтаксис Excel, который начинается со знака равенства. Функция ABS относится к категории математических и требует указания одного обязательного аргумента — числа, модуль которого нужно найти. Аргументом может выступать непосредственное числовое значение, ссылка на ячейку или результат другого вычисления. Структура запроса выглядит предельно лаконично и не требует сложных настроек.

Для ввода формулы перейдите в ячейку результата и наберите следующую конструкцию:

=ABS(число)

Где число — это обязательный аргумент. Если вы ссылаетесь на ячейку A1, содержащую значение -150, формула =ABS(A1) вернет результат 150. . Поэтомуьте, что исходные данные имеют числовой формат.

⚠️ Внимание: Функция ABS не работает с текстовыми представлениями чисел. Если ваши данные импортированы из другой системы и содержат скрытые пробелы или апострофы, предварительно очистите их, иначе расчет модуля приведет к ошибке.

Особенность работы функции заключается в том, что она обрабатывает данные в реальном времени. Если вы измените значение в исходной ячейке с отрицательного на положительное, результат функции ABS не изменится, так как модуль положительного числа равен самому себе. Это делает инструмент универсальным для обработки смешанных массивов данных, где знаки могут меняться динамически.

📊 Как часто вы используете функцию ABS в работе?
Ежедневно
Раз в неделю
Редко, только для отчетов
Никогда не использовал

Пошаговая инструкция: как вставить модуль в таблицу

Процесс внедрения расчета модуля в вашу таблицу занимает считанные секунды, но требует внимательности при выборе аргументов. Сначала необходимо определить диапазон данных, с которыми будет вестись работа. Допустим, в столбце A у вас записаны значения дебиторской задолженности, где отрицательные числа означают переплату. Вам нужно создать столбец B, где все суммы будут положительными для итогового отчета.

Выполните следующие действия для автоматизации процесса:

  • 📌 Выделите ячейку, в которой должен появиться результат, и введите знак = для начала формулы.
  • 📌 Наберите название функции ABS или выберите ее из выпадающего списка подсказок, появляющегося при вводе.
  • 📌 Укажите ссылку на ячейку с исходным числом (например, кликните мышкой по ячейке A2) или введите число вручную.
  • 📌 Закройте скобку ) и нажмите Enter, чтобы зафиксировать вычисление.

После получения первого результата нет необходимости повторять процедуру для каждой строки вручную. Excel позволяет масштабировать формулу на весь столбец данных. Для этого подведите курсор к правому нижнему углу ячейки с формулой, пока он не превратится в черный крестик (маркер заполнения), и потяните вниз до конца таблицы. Относительные ссылки автоматически адаптируются, и модуль будет рассчитан для всех строк.

☑️ Проверка корректности формулы

Выполнено: 0 / 1

Если в процессе протягивания формулы вы обнаружили ошибки #ССЫЛКА! или #ИМЯ?, проверьте, не сбилась ли ссылка на исходную ячейку. При использовании абсолютных ссылок (с символами $) диапазон не будет смещаться, что может быть нужно в редких случаях, но для столбцов обычно требуются относительные ссылки. Убедитесь, что формат ячейки результата установлен как Общий или Числовой, чтобы избежать некорректного отображения.

Практические примеры применения модуля

Функция ABS находит широкое применение не только в чистой математике, но и в бизнес-аналитике, инженерии и статистике. Одним из классических примеров является расчет отклонений фактических показателей от плановых. Если план составлял 100 единиц, а факт — 90 или 110, разница будет -10 и +10 соответственно. Для анализа точности планирования нам важно абсолютное значение ошибки, а не ее направление.

Рассмотрим таблицу с примерами использования функции в различных сценариях:

Сценарий Исходные данные Формула Результат
Финансы -5000 (убыток) =ABS(A2) 5000
Логистика -120 (км отклонения) =ABS(A3) 120
Температура -5.5 (градуса) =ABS(A4) 5.5
Время -30 (минут опоздания) =ABS(A5) 30

Еще один важный кейс — расчет средней абсолютной ошибки (MAE) в прогнозировании. Здесь модуль применяется к разнице между прогнозируемым и реальным значением перед усреднением. Без использования ABS положительные и отрицательные ошибки могли бы компенсировать друг друга, создавая иллюзию высокой точности прогноза, хотя фактически отклонения могли быть значительными. Это критически важный момент для Data Science аналитиков.

⚠️ Внимание: При расчете средней ошибки никогда не усредняйте raw-разницы (без модуля), так как положительная и отрицательная погрешности могут взаимно уничтожиться, скрыв реальную неточность модели.

Комбинирование ABS с другими функциями

Мощь Excel раскрывается при комбинации простых функций для решения сложных задач. Функцию модуля часто вкладывают внутрь других математических или логических операторов. Например, для подсчета суммы всех отклонений независимо от знака можно использовать конструкцию =SUM(ABS(диапазон)). Однако, поскольку SUM не умеет работать с массивами в обычном режиме без специальных клавиш, в современных версиях Excel (Office 365) это работает автоматически, а в старых требуется нажатие Ctrl+Shift+Enter.

Также модуль полезен в связке с логической функцией IF (ЕСЛИ). Вы можете создать условие, которое проверяет, превышает ли модуль числа определенный порог. Например, формула =IF(ABS(A1)>100,"Критично","Норма") позволит отфильтровать значения, которые отклоняются от нуля более чем на 100 единиц, независимо от того, в какую сторону направлено отклонение. Это упрощает создание систем мониторинга и алертов.

Секрет динамических массивов

В новых версиях Excel формула =SUM(ABS(A1:A10)) работает как обычная. В старых версиях (2016 и ранее) нужно вводить её как формулу массива, иначе получите ошибку #ЗНАЧ!.

Другой вариант использования — совместная работа с функциями округления. Если вам нужно округлить модуль числа до целого, используйте =ROUND(ABS(A1), 0). Это часто требуется при формировании отчетов, где дробные части не имеют смысла, а знак числа должен быть проигнорирован. Комбинирование функций позволяет создавать гибкие и мощные инструменты анализа данных прямо внутри ячейки.

Типичные ошибки и методы их устранения

При работе с функцией модуля пользователи часто сталкиваются с типовыми проблемами, которые легко решаются при понимании природы данных. Самая распространенная ошибка — получение результата #ЗНАЧ! (или #VALUE!). Это происходит, когда в качестве аргумента передается текст. Даже если в ячейке написано"-50", но формат ячейки текстовый, Excel не сможет выполнить математическую операцию. Решение заключается в использовании функции VALUE или инструмента"Текст по столбцам" для конвертации данных.

Еще одна проблема — неожиданный результат при работе с датами. В Excel даты хранятся как числа, поэтому функция ABS применима и к ним. Однако, если вы вычитаете одну дату из другой и получаете отрицательное число дней, применение модуля вернет количество дней, но формат может сбиться. Убедитесь, что ячейка с результатом отформатирована как Числовой, а не как Дата, если вы ожидаете увидеть количество дней, а не конкретную дату в 1900 году.

Функция ABS игнорирует знак числа, но не меняет его формат: если исходное значение было валютой, результат также следует отформатировать как валюту вручную.

Если формула возвращает #ИМЯ?, проверьте правильность написания названия функции. В русифицированных версиях Excel название может быть переведено как ABS (чаще всего оставляется латиницей) или, в редких случаях, адаптировано, но стандарт Microsoft сохраняет английские названия математических функций. Убедитесь, что разделителем аргументов служит правильный символ: в русской локали это обычно точка с запятой ;, а в английской — запятая ,.

Часто задаваемые вопросы (FAQ)

Можно ли поставить модуль без использования функции ABS?

Технически можно использовать математический трюк: умножить число на само себя и извлечь квадратный корень =SQRT(A1^2). Однако это менее производительно и менее читаемо для других пользователей. Функция ABS является стандартом и работает быстрее.

Работает ли функция ABS с комплексными числами?

В стандартном Excel функция ABS работает только с вещественными числами. Для работы с комплексными числами (вида 3+4i) существует отдельная функция IMABS, которая возвращает модуль комплексного числа. Использование обычной ABS на комплексном числе приведет к ошибке.

Как быстро убрать все минусы в столбце навсегда?

Если вам нужно не формулой, а физически изменить данные: введите -1 в пустую ячейку, скопируйте ее, выделите столбец с числами, нажмите правой кнопкой мыши ->"Специальная вставка" ->"Умножить". Это перемножит все числа на -1, изменив их знак.

Почему модуль отрицательного времени дает странный результат?

Excel хранит время как дробную часть суток. Если вы видите странные числа, переформатируйте ячейку. Функция ABS корректно обрабатывает время, но результат нужно правильно интерпретировать (например, 0.5 — это 12 часов).